Sunshine Coast Airport
The Maroochydore/ Sunshine Coast Airport is a small airport linking the Sunshine Coast Region to major cities such as Melbourne, Sydney and Adelaide.
The Airport boasts various facilities including shops, a kiosk, and a lounge where you can relax and watch TV.

Brisbane Airport
The Sunshine Coast is about 75 drive from Brisbane Airport, and so if you are International travellers it is more than likely that you stop by Brisbane.
Brisbane Airport is home to a great range of airline facilities including Brisbane's World Class International and Domestic airports.
Over 3.4 million international travellers land in Brisbane each year aboard one of the 23 airlines servicing 26 international destinations including the Middle East, Europe, China, the United Kingdom and the west coast of the United States of America.
Furthermore, 5 domestic carriers service regional areas throughout the country including the major capitals, carrying over 11.7 million passengers each year.
